Last Friday the Concerts at the Mural series came to an end. Though we may be sad that it’s over, we certainly couldn’t have had a more festive and well-attended night. The finale was a special No Depression night, featuring four newer bands carrying on the traditions of the flagship “alt-country” publisher. Former Seattleite Shane Tutmarc returned home from Nashville to headline the evening that also included the genre-bending (and oft signature-changing) Ravenna Woods, the gospel-loving Pickwick, and dark woods-traversing Portland band Drew Grow and the Pastors’ Wives.
